Nature of Application. 1.1 A creditor of a company can make an application to the Court under s459P of the Corporations Act for orders winding up the company in insolvency under s459A. 1.2 The most common basis for an application under s459P is that the subject company has failed to comply with a Statutory Demand and is …

(10) Delete Order 56 rule 35(2) and insert: (2) A copy … WitrynaYou will need to be admitted to the legal profession by the Supreme Court of Western Australia if you intend to practice law in Western Australia. Admission to the legal profession is a prerequisite for obtaining a practising certificate. You will not be able to practice law after admission until you have been granted a practising certificate.
